SHC orders Customs to release vehicle detained for fake auction documents

byCT Report
18/10/2017
in Karachi
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

KARACHI: A Sindh High Court’s customs appellate bench has ordered release of a Toyota X series.

A customs appellate bench, comprising Justice Munib Akhtar and Justice Omar Sial, was hearing a constitution petition filed by owner of a vehicle duly purchased locally.

According to details Fazal Subhan who deals in US Immigration cases and a psychologist was going to Jinnah Post Graduate Medical Centre (JPMC) with his wife Dr Fareeda, Gynaecologist on Sept 11, 2017 as she was called to attend an emergency case when DIT officials intercepted the vehicle.

The owners/occupants presented all documents including purchase papers, import documents, ABL Loan documents, on Line verification from Motor Vehicle Registration but they forcible took away the vehicle, submitted counsel Ms Dil Khurram Shaheen advocate.

The act of respondents was in excess of authority and illegal as vehicle was duly purchased locally and all proofs have been annexed with the petition, she contended. Earlier Yawar Abbas officer of DIT appeared before the court with vehicle and submitted that auction documents are fake.

The bench however after hearing the sides ordered handing over vehicle to the claimant/owner as an interim measure while registration book of the vehicle would remain in custody of the Nazir of SHC till disposal of the petition.
